Plastic Sheets for Door: A Popular Choice
Plastic sheets for doors have gained immense popularity due to their versatility and cost-effectiveness. They come in a wide range of thicknesses, colors, and textures, making them a highly adaptable solution for various needs. One of the primary advantages of plastic sheet doors is their resistance to water, dust, and other environmental elements. This makes them ideal for exterior doors, particularly in areas with harsh weather conditions.
Moreover, plastic sheets are relatively easy to install. Many DIY enthusiasts prefer them because they can be cut to size and attached to the door frame using simple tools and adhesives. This ease of installation, combined with their low maintenance requirements, makes plastic sheets a practical choice for both residential and commercial applications.
Types of Plastic Sheets for Doors
Within the category of plastic sheets for doors, several sub-types exist, each with its unique properties:
Polyethylene (PE) Sheets: Known for their flexibility and chemical resistance, PE sheets are suitable for a variety of door applications. They are lightweight and can be easily formed to fit irregular door shapes.
Polyvinyl Chloride (PVC) Sheets: PVC sheets offer superior durability and strength. They are highly resistant to impact, making them ideal for high-traffic areas. Additionally, PVC sheets can be made transparent or opaque, providing flexibility in terms of aesthetics and privacy.
Acrylic Sheets: Acrylic sheets are known for their clarity and optical properties, making them a favorite for decorative door covers. They are lightweight yet strong, with excellent weather resistance. However, acrylic sheets tend to be more expensive than PE and PVC options.

Door Cover Sheets: Beyond Plastic
While plastic sheets are indeed a popular and effective choice, they are not the only option available. Other materials such as metal, glass, and fabric can also be used as door cover sheets, depending on the specific requirements. For instance, metal sheets might be preferred for security purposes, while glass sheets can add a touch of elegance and light to any space.
Fabric door cover sheets, on the other hand, offer a softer, more decorative approach. They are often used in interior doors to add texture and color to the room. While fabric sheets may not provide the same level of protection as plastic or metal, they can significantly enhance the aesthetic appeal of a space.
Considerations for Selection
When selecting a door cover sheet, it's important to consider the specific needs of your application. Consider factors such as the environment (interior vs. exterior), the level of protection required, and your budget. For instance, if you're looking for a durable, weather-resistant solution for an exterior door, a PVC or PE plastic sheet might be the best choice. On the other hand, if you're aiming for a stylish, decorative look for an interior door, a fabric or acrylic sheet could be more suitable.
